Prairie Ridge at Rathbun Lake is praised for its great fishing, peaceful atmosphere, and family-friendly environment, making it ideal for reunions. Campers appreciate the friendly staff, clean facilities, and beautiful lake views, although some express concerns about the rough access roads and inadequate shower facilities. Overall, visitors enjoy the campground's tranquility and plan to return despite some minor drawbacks.

Location Prairie Ridge (rathbun Lake)
Address:
20112 Hwy J5 T
Centerville, IA, 52544-8308
United States
From Moravia, IA, travel 4 miles west on Highway J18, then south 2.5 miles on 200th Avenue (gravel). Follow signs into campground.
Latitude & Longitude: 40.8769 / -92.8872
Elevation: 286 feet
Policies & Rules
| Category | About |
|---|---|
| General |
14 Day Policy on Rathbun Lake: Campers are only allowed to camp at the same camping loop a maximum of 14 nights within a 30 night period. After the 14th night, they will be required to move (physically move the camping unit) to a different camping loop, which can be in the same campground. |
| General |
If late, you must contact this park within 24 hours after your original check-in time or you will be considered a 'no show' resulting in the cancelation of your reservation. |
| General |
Please register for campsites during booth hours, 8 a.m.-10 a.m. and 3 p.m.-8 p.m. |
